title = "Research on air combat parallel simulation system based on OpenMP and Windows multithreading API",
abstract = "Design method of air combat parallel simulation system which is suitable for running in the multi-core environment is proposed. The system can be divided into some weak coupling modules. Simulation entity is abstracted which is the step unit when the system runs in parallel mode. Parallel framework is designed in two ways: OpenMP and Windows API, which can be take advantage of the multi-core CPU to avoid the overhead of transmitting large amounts of data over the network in the DIS sometimes. Analyzing the features of two kinds of thread method, it confirms that the design method is feasible through the simulation experiments.",
